Main themes
- Children's biological development
- Physiological adaptations of the child to exercise and physical training
- Anatomy and physiology specific to women
- Physiological adaptations of women to exercise and physical training
- Biological theories of ageing
- Physiological adaptations of the elderly to exercise and physical training
